Nutrients

How to fertilize Common Turricula

Nutrient, fertilizer, and repotting needs for Common Turricula: repot after 2X growth

Most potting soils come with ample nutrients which plants use to produce new growth.

By the time your plant has depleted the nutrients in its soil it’s likely grown enough to need a larger pot anyway.

To replenish this plant's nutrients, repot your Common Turricula after it doubles in size or once a year—whichever comes first.
